7.21.2.4 match any
This command adds to the specified class definition a match condition whereby all packets are
considered to belong to the class.
Syntax
match any
Default Setting
None
Command Mode
Class-Map Config / Ipv6-Class-Map Config
7.21.2.5 match class-map
This command adds to the specified class definition the set of match conditions defined for another
class.
Syntax
match class-map <refclassname>
<refclassname> is the name of an existing DiffServ class whose match conditions are being
referenced by the specified class definition.
There is no [not] option for this match command.
